Windows命令列kill程序小技巧

2021-06-22 02:24:35 字數 1524 閱讀 7639



我使用的是 第二個命令 taskkill.exe

重啟的時候,寫乙個bat 檔案

在進行滲透測試的時候,難免會碰到某些軟體影響滲透測試的進一步進行,所以在這種時候需要一些手段或工具結束一些阻礙滲透的程序,本文分享了三個結束程序的小tips,純科普文,只為拋磚引玉,各位牛輕噴,如下:

1、pskill.exe

pskill可能是microsoft windows命令列裡面最古老和最常用的結束程序的方法,很早以前是國外安全研究院mark russinovich開發的sysinternals工具包裡面的乙個工具,現在被微軟收購。

可以傳輸乙個程序的pid號,然後通過pskill結束該程序。

c:\> pskill $pid
2、taskkill.exe

taskkill命令是microsoft windows內建的一款命令,可以用來終止程序,具體的命令規則如下:

taskkill [/s system [/u username [/p [password]]]]  [/f] [/t]
引數列表:

/s system 指定要連線到的遠端系統。

/u [domain\]user 指定應該在哪個使用者上下文

執行這個命令。

/p [password] 為提供的使用者上下文指定密碼。如果忽略,提示輸入。

/f 指定要強行終止的程序。

/fi filter 指定篩選進或篩選出查詢的的任務。

/pid process id 指定要終止的程序的pid。

/im image name 指定要終止的程序的影象名。萬用字元 '*'可用來指定所有影象名。

/t tree kill: 終止指定的程序和任何由此啟動的子程序。

/? 顯示幫助/用法。

示例

taskkill /s system /f /im notepad.exe /t

taskkill /pid 1230 /pid 1241 /pid 1253 /t

taskkill /f /im qq.exe

3、processhacker工具processhacker是國外安全研究者開發的一款專門用於結束程序的工具,詳見這裡,可以用它結束一些常見的防毒軟體程序,使用方法如下:

c:\> processhacker.exe -c -ctype process -cobject $pid-number -caction terminate
也是暫停程序的執行,如下:

c:\> processhacker.exe -c -ctype process -cobject $pid-number –caction suspend

windows命令列指令

stpeace 在介紹windows批處命令前,我們首先來介紹windows命令列的使用。windows shell提供了乙個黑色的框框介面,即命令列操作介面,關於命令列的作用和好處,我就不費口舌了,下面僅窺見一斑。為了方便,免得進行碟符切換,我在f盤建立了乙個資料夾,名稱為myfile,把wind...

windows命令列操作

一 開啟方式 開始選單 執行 輸入cmd 回車 二 常用的指令 dir 列出當前目錄下的所有檔案 cd 目錄名 進入到指定目錄 md 目錄名 建立乙個資料夾 rd 目錄名 刪除乙個資料夾 type nul 檔名 建立乙個空的檔案 echo 檔案內容 檔名 建立乙個有內容的檔案 del 檔名 刪除指定...

windows命令列尋找使用某一埠的程序

有時因為各種需要,希望找到自己 電腦上占用某個埠的程序,使用圖形介面要特點工具,在命令列下,只要netstat命令和tasklist命令配合,很方便就可以找到。首先,使用netstat anob find 本機ip 埠 命令,可以列出使用這個埠的程序號,如檢視 本機使用埠49620的程序號 或使用n...